Job Description

Job Summary

The District Manager directs, coaches, and provides leadership for stores within a district. Overall, this role manages the sales, store operations, staffing and development, team member relations, merchandising, loss prevention and expense control for the assigned district. Accountable for achieving District and Company overall profitability expectations and ensures compliance is met for all company policies and procedures.

Key Qualifications & Requirements:

  • Minimum 4 years Retail Management experience with at least 3 years of multi-unit experience or 5 years as a top performing Windsor Store Manager
  • Proven leadership experience
  • Proven experience in multi-tasking and organization
  • Ability to develop and motivate a team of up to 15 stores
  • Able to resolve complaints and problems as they arise from customers and team members
  • Communicates well and effectively in a one and one setting and in a group setting
  • Ability to use cash register, computer and other technology
  • Able to travel and drive as needed

Physical/Environmental Demands and Overtime & Availability:

Frequently stands, walks, observes, bends and pushes. Must be able to count, communicate, read and write in English. Must be able to: access all areas of the store including selling floor, stock area and register area, operate and use all equipment necessary to run the store, climb ladders, move or handle merchandise or supplies throughout the store (generally weighing from 0-25 pounds) and work varied hours/days to oversee store operations. Environment is fast paced and indoor temperature conditions vary.
